The Bullring shopping centre has long been a focal point of Birmingham city centre and, following its extensive redevelopment in 2003, has been restored as one of the midland’s foremost shopping and entertainment complexes. Opened in May 1964 by the Duke of Edinburgh, the original Birmingham Bull Ring centre was a combination of outdoor market stalls and Britain’s first indoor shopping mall.
